Staffing Ratio Comparison

How Quandialla Public School's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.

Quandialla Public
6.7:1
NSW Average
12.7:1
National Average
12.3:1

With a ratio of 6.7:1, this school has a better student-to-teacher ratio than both the NSW average (12.7: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
